The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in High Point,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Installation Costs - The typical cost for home foundation installation can range from $4,000 to $15,000 depending on the size and type of foundation. For example, a small crawl space foundation might cost around $4,500, while a full basement could be closer to $14,000. Costs vary based on local labor rates and soil conditions.
Material Expenses - Material costs for foundation work generally account for a significant portion of the total, often between $2,000 and $8,000. Concrete, rebar, and gravel are common expenses, with concrete alone possibly costing around $3,500 for an average-sized home. Material prices fluctuate based on quality and supplier rates.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for foundation installation typically range from $2,500 to $7,500, influenced by project complexity and local wage rates. Larger or more complex foundations, such as those requiring excavation or reinforcement, tend to be at the higher end of this range. Local pros may charge more for expedited or specialized services.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ses might include permits, site preparation, and drainage solutions, which can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the overall budget. For example, addressing drainage issues or soil stabilization could increase costs depending on site conditions. These factors should be considered when estimating total project exp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in home foundation installation? Home foundation installation typically includes site preparation, excavation, and the construction of a suitable foundation type based on the property's needs, such as concrete slabs or crawl spaces. Local contractors can provide detailed assessments and perform the necessary work.
How do I know if my home needs foundation work? Signs that may indicate foundation issues include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ly. Consulting with a local foundation specialist can help determine if repairs or new installation are needed.
What types of foundation options are available? Common foundation types include conc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and basement foundations. A local professional can recommend the best option based on soil conditions and the home’s design.
How long does a home foundation install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, installation can take several days to a few weeks. A local contractor can provide a more specific timeline after assessment.
What factors influence the cost of foundation installation? Costs depend on factors such as the foundation type, soil conditions, property size, and site accessibility. Contacting local service providers can help obtain estimates tailored to specific needs.
